Output c8f89a9bda4b80d37632b02d157c00969fe630ce81380642497f528011478042:12

value
31752
script pubkey
OP_0 OP_PUSHBYTES_20 43ce588f3afe512492b2e515175a0c257f119c8a
address
bc1qg0893re6legjfy4ju523wksvy4l3r8y2vucm6c
transaction
c8f89a9bda4b80d37632b02d157c00969fe630ce81380642497f528011478042
confirmations
239685
spent
true